Secret Features to Consider Before Purchasing

When shopping for a treadmill, bear in mind several important functions that can significantly affect your experience.

1. Motor Power

  • Determined in Horsepower (HP): A good treadmill needs to have a motor of a minimum of 2.0 HP for walking and 3.0 HP for running.
  • Continuous Duty vs. Peak HP: Continuous duty horsepower is a more trusted measurement for efficiency in time.

2. Treadmill Size

  • Running Surface: For running, a track size of a minimum of 55 inches in length is suggested.
  • Foldability: If space is an issue, select a treadmill that can be folded up after usage.

3. Cushioning System

  • Impact Reduction: Look for treadmills with cushioning to reduce pressure on joints, particularly for long-distance running.

4. Workout Programs and Connectivity

  • Pre-programmed Programs: Many treadmills come equipped with a variety of built-in exercise programs.
  • App Integration: Some designs offer connection to physical fitness apps for boosted tracking and engagement.

5. Price and Warranty

Cost RangeNormal Features
Under ₤ 500Basic features, restricted programs, smaller motor.
₤ 500 - ₤ 1,000Medium motor power, more programs, better develop quality.
₤ 1,000 - ₤ 2,000Advanced functions, high durability, extensive warranty.
Above ₤ 2,000Commercial-grade machines with all possible features.

Frequently Asked Questions About Buying Treadmills

1. How much area do I need for a treadmill?

  • Preferably, set aside at least 6 feet in length and 3 feet in width for safe use and maneuvering.

2. Do I need a treadmill with a high motor power?

  • If you prepare to use it for running, a motor with a minimum of 3.0 HP is recommended for durability and performance.

3. Should I buy a treadmill with integrated workout programs?

  • Yes, integrated programs can help improve motivation and provide structure to your exercises.

4. Are folding treadmills worth it?

  • Yes, they are advantageous for people with restricted area. Simply guarantee it has a strong locking mechanism for security.

5. What's the best way to keep my treadmill?

  • Routinely tidy the machine, lubricate the belt, and occasionally look for loose parts or any indications of wear.
